‘Curious refereeing decisions’ – Ralf Rangnick points finger at official after Man Utd crash out of Champions League

Ralf Rangnick questioned the “curious refereeing decisions” after Manchester United were knocked out of the Champions League by Atletico Madrid. A 1-0 win at Old Trafford was enough to help Atletico reach the quarter-finals and signal another trophyless season for United. Ad/> Interim boss Rangnick was irked by the performance of Slavko Vincic, accusing the official of falling for Atletico’s stalling tactics in the second half and wondering why only four minutes of stoppage time were added on.
